Skillinvest is a not-for-profit Group Training & Registered Training Organisation delivering training in many Industry sectors.

Skillinvests’ Hairdressing department is seeking a Trainer and Assessor to join our team in Geelong, Western Suburbs, Ballarat VIC, to deliver training and assessment to a range of student cohorts. Delivering the Certificate III in Hairdressing SHB30416 in a workplace on-the-job model for 3 days per week.

W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ING

  • Deliver high quality training to students
  • Prepare for and deliver training and assessment services in accordance with Skillinvest’s RTO policies and procedures
  • Adjust/develop flexible teaching and learning strategies to assist students with barriers to learning e.g. low literacy levels or disabilities
  • Maintain currency of knowledge in relevant training packages and vocational industry
  • Be able to work and contribute to part of a team and work autonomously as required
  • Develop strong relationships with students, staff, schools and other stakeholders

IS THIS YOU?

  • Hairdressing Trade Qualification
  • Minimum of 5 years’ experience in the Hairdressing Industry
  • TAE40116 Certificate IV in Training and Assessment (or equivalent)
  • Current Employee Working with Children Check and Police Check

 You must have a strong customer focus and a willingness to work as part of a growing team, in a fast-paced environment. You should enjoy sharing your knowledge and experience with people new to the industry and can create flexible assessment tools according to Workplace conditions and Training Package standards.
